background
Operating in 11 states across the U.S.,
Mercury Insurance
provides car and home insurance to residents.
The company was founded in 1961 in California and is headquartered in Los Angeles. Originally started to serve as a low-cost alternative to more expensive policies from the larger insurance companies of the time, Mercury has garnered numerous accolades, including being named a Top Five Best Auto Insurance Company by Insure.com and one of America's Best Midsize Employers by Forbes magazine.

States Mercury Insurance is offered

Unlike many insurance companies, Mercury Insurance focuses on just a few states. The 11 states that Mercury operates in include:
  • Arizona
  • California
  • Florida
  • Georgia
  • Illinois
  • Nevada
  • New Jersey
  • New York
  • Oklahoma
  • Texas
  • Virginia

Available Mercury Insurance apps

Mercury Insurance also offers a couple of apps for its customers, including Mercury Portal and Mercury Assist.
The
Mercury Portal
app for Android allows customers to view their policy, make a payment, and contact an agent, all from their mobile device.
The
Mercury Assist
app for Apple devices allows Mercury customers to access 24-hour emergency and accident assistance with Total Care, as well as to connect directly to a Mercury Case Manager through its Live Chat function.

Mercury Insurance ratings and reviews

One of the easiest ways to check out the validity of a company is through its ratings with the BBB and A.M. Best. The BBB rating signifies a company's responsiveness to complaints from customers, while its A.M. Best rating serves as an indicator of a company's financial stability.
According to the BBB, Mercury Insurance has an
A- rating
, indicating that the company responds quickly to customer complaints and typically has a favorable resolution to customer problems.
According to A.M. Best, Mercury has an
A+ rating
. This rating indicates that Mercury Insurance has an overall good financial outlook, though recently the company downgraded Mercury Insurance's "financial outlook" to "negative" due to liability losses for car accidents in Florida and California from 2012 through 2014.
